SHAKESPEARE IN THE PARK
The Shakespeare in the Park program was organized in 2004 and has presented the following productions:

In recent years this FREE annual event produced by EPAC for the public has transformed into an abridged version performed by EPAC Kids! EPAC has now also added a Shakespearean Festival in the park to enhance this community event!

Shakespeare in the Park is made possible with public funds from the Statewide Community Regrants Program, a regrant program of the New York State Council on the Arts with the support of the Office of the Governor and the New York State Legislature, and administered by The Earlville Opera House. Additional support for the Broome SCR Program graciously provided by the Stewart W. and Willma C. Hoyt Foundation, Inc.




The EPAC Youth Troupe produces an abridged version of Shakespeare in the Park every year for FREE at The George W. Johnson Park in Endicott, NY.
